Transaction 751816bd77bfce86c055b0ea85eed00892b9077c71c502416e30d6d760db30ff

2 Input
1 Outputs
  • 751816bd77bfce86c055b0ea85eed00892b9077c71c502416e30d6d760db30ff:0
  • value  450777
    address  34bddPRtjNsTY4HFPtZC2CA3j7wDHYtV9P